Tensions Boil Over in New York as Curtis Jones Caught in Furious On-Pitch Argument with Liverpool Teammates After Wrexham Win

Liverpool’s pre-season tour of the United States took an unexpected turn on Wednesday night when midfielder Curtis Jones was caught in an animated, seemingly furious discussion with several of his own teammates immediately after the final whistle of their pre-season victory over Wrexham. The Reds continued their positive momentum under new manager Andoni Iraola at Yankee Stadium in New York, securing a hard-fought win against Championship opposition following their earlier pre-season triumph over Sunderland on Saturday. The decisive moment on the pitch came courtesy of teenage talent Rio Ngumoha, who netted a fine second-half goal to seal the victory. However, the positive atmosphere surrounding the team’s performance was quickly overshadowed by dramatic scenes at full-time involving Jones, whose unresolved transfer saga appears to be compounding on-pitch frustrations.

Fan-shot video footage captured in the stands showed the 25-year-old midfielder—who had entered the match as a second-half substitute in the 50th minute—engaging in a heated exchange on the pitch. Jones was initially seen gesturing expressively while speaking directly to Hungary national team captain Dominik Szoboszlai. Szoboszlai appeared to be acting as a peacemaker, attempting to calm his teammate’s visible anger as the dialogue intensified. However, rather than resolving the issue, Jones turned away from Szoboszlai only to be immediately confronted by defender Kostas Tsimikas and summer signing Jeremie Frimpong. Frimpong was forced to step in physical intervention, gently pushing Jones back to prevent him from stepping forward and escalating the confrontation further before leading the Academy graduate away from the fray while Jones continued to passionately plead his case.

Transfer Standoff Deepens as Inter Milan See £21.7m Bid Rejected by Reds Hierarchy

The fiery post-match incident comes against a backdrop of intense uncertainty regarding Jones’s long-term future at Anfield. The midfielder is widely expected to depart the club during the current summer transfer window, but Liverpool chiefs are holding firm on their financial valuation. As reported by Daily Mail Sport last week, Italian giants Inter Milan saw a second formal proposal for the player firmly rebuffed by the Anfield hierarchy. The Serie A side’s offer of £21.7 million was deemed significantly below Liverpool’s asking price, leading to a standstill in negotiations between the two clubs.

Although Jones has entered the final twelve months of his current contract, Liverpool executives are in no rush to sell the homegrown talent on the cheap. The club’s stance remains resolute: they would prefer to retain Jones for the remainder of his contract and allow him to walk away for free next summer rather than sanction a discounted departure below their target valuation of between £35 million and £40 million. Towards the tail end of last season under former manager Arne Slot, Jones grew increasingly disillusioned at Anfield after losing his starting berth and spending extended periods on the substitutes’ bench, accelerating his desire to seek fresh challenges elsewhere.
